STMicroelectronics completes acquisition of NXP's MEMS sensor business

STMicroelectronics has completed the acquisition of NXP Semiconductors' MEMS sensor business. The transaction, announced in July 2025, has now received regulatory approval. This acquisition strengthens ST's position in sensor solutions for the automotive industry, for both safety-critical and non-safety-critical applications, as well as for industrial uses, expanding its global sensor expertise and market position. The acquired business is expected to generate mid-double-digit million US dollars in revenue in Q1 2026. The move is driven by growing demand for MEMS sensors in driver assistance, safety systems, and industrial applications, allowing ST to offer more comprehensive solutions. As a global integrated semiconductor manufacturer, ST serves automotive, industrial, energy, consumer electronics, and communication markets while pursuing sustainability goals. This acquisition continues ST's strategy of targeted investment in key technologies for safety-critical and industrial electronics
